ruby-saml -- XML signature wrapping attack
RubySec reports: ruby-saml prior to version 1.3.0 is vulnerable to an XML signature wrapping attack in the specific scenario where there was a signature that referenced at the same time 2 elements but past the scheme validator process since 1 of the element was inside the encrypted assertion...

apache-cxf: SAML SSO processing is vulnerable to wrapping attack
It was found that Apache CXF permitted wrapping attacks in its support for SAML SSO. A malicious user could construct a SAML response that would bypass the login screen and possibly gain access to restricted information or resources...

wss4j: Apache WSS4J doesn't correctly enforce the requireSignedEncryptedDataElements property
It was found that Apache WSS4J permitted bypass of the requireSignedEncryptedDataElements configuration property via XML Signature wrapping attacks. A remote attacker could use this flaw to modify the contents of a signed request...
